$3M Invested In ModRobotics And Colorado’s Tech Future
Intelligent cubes take additive robotics to the next level
By Casey Nobile

Venture capitalist Brad Feld continues to advance the evolution of Colorado’s tech ecosystem with his most recent investment in Modular Robotics. Feld’s VC firm, Foundry Group, recently invested $3 million in the maker of robot construction kits for children. The cash will allow the start-up to expand its facilities and increase its order fulfillment capacity.

“I believe the machines have already taken over and are just patiently waiting for us to catch up with them. As part of this, every kid should learn how to program, create things, and work with robots. ModRobotics plans to be an integral part of that,” Brad Feld, Foundry Group Co-Founder
